Keeping Doctors Happy in WA's South-West

  • Year: 2011
  • Author: Comparti, Alison
  • Journal Name: Health Issues
  • Journal Number: No. 105
  • Country: Australia
  • State/Region: Western Australia

Attracting doctors to regional areas like the south-west of Western Australia is a sophisticated marketing challenge that requires local community action and some red-tape cutting by governments.
